William few’s main contribution to the constitutional convention was
EleoNora [17]

William few’s main contribution to the constitutional convention was delivering nationalist votes at crucial times.

C) delivering nationalist votes at crucial times.

<u>Explanation:</u>

William Few was a son British men moved from England to Pennsylvania. Few entered into the politics and elected in the Georgia province's congress.

He served for the continental congress( during the period 1780-88) and also elected again for the Georgia province's assembly(1783). Later, he got appointed with one of the six delegates of the Constitutional Convention in 1787 parallel along with congress.

He missed a lot of meetings because of congress's service so he never made a speech at the convention. Yet he came up with nationalist votes at the critical times for the country.

According to the _______ theory, pain sensations may be inhibited by psychological factors like a person's tolerance to pain, or
yKpoI14uk [10]

Answer:

Gate control theory.

Explanation:

This question wants to test our knowledge on health Psychology that is to say the perception of pain for instance how high the scale of pain is whether it is Acute or chronic.

Gate control theory explains how the body respond to pain by blocking it. Pain can be blocked through psychological factors or by using neurotransmitters such as endorphins.

According to Gate control theory pain can be blocked by using ng medications such as Narcotics and Analgesics.
